    When molten material cools very slowly deep inside the Earth, the crystals that form are larger than those formed closer to the Earth's surface. This is because slower cooling allows more time for the atoms to arrange themselves into a more ordered crystalline structure, resulting in larger crystals. Therefore, the correct answer is:
**The crystals are larger than those formed closer to Earth’s surface.**
